South Western Railway has successfully completed field trials of the indigenous KAVACH automatic train protection system on key routes in the Bengaluru Division. The system is designed to prevent collisions and improve operational safety through automated intervention.

South Western Railway (SWR) has successfully conducted field trials of the Standard KAVACH Automatic Train Protection (ATP) system across key sections of the Bengaluru Division, a step towards improving train safety and operational efficiency, according to SWR.
